10 Middlegate Close

    10, MIDDLEGATE CLOSE, BARROW-UPON-HUMBER, DN19 7SR

    This semi-detached freehold property on Middlegate Close last sold in July 2025 for £165,000. Based on price growth in the DN19 district since then, its estimated current value is £165,000 — placing it in the 16th percentile nationally and the 22nd percentile within DN19. The property covers 117 m² (1,259 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,410 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— DN19

    DN19 covers the market towns and rural areas of north Lincolnshire, situated in the East Midlands between the Humber and the Wolds. It is a quieter, more established residential area with a focus on owner-occupied family homes and traditional community appeal.
